Designing Workshops for Diverse Teams
Creating effective leadership communication workshops for diverse teams requires a thoughtful and strategic approach. These workshops should be tailored to accommodate the unique needs and dynamics of diverse groups. Here are key considerations for designing impactful workshops:
Tailoring Content to Meet Diverse Needs
Each team is different, with varying cultures, communication styles, and dynamics. It's essential to customize workshop content to reflect these differences. This can involve:
Assessing team demographics to understand cultural backgrounds
Incorporating relevant case studies that resonate with participants
Adapting activities to ensure they are culturally inclusive
Incorporating Interactive Elements and Team-Building Exercises
To enhance engagement and retention of concepts, workshops should include interactive elements. These can help participants apply what they’re learning in real-time. Consider incorporating:
Group discussions that encourage sharing personal insights
Role-playing scenarios to practice conflict resolution and active listening
Team-building exercises that facilitate collaboration and trust-building
Ensuring Inclusivity in Discussions and Activities
Creating a safe and respectful environment for discussion is vital for diverse teams. Facilitators should establish ground rules to promote open dialogue and ensure everyone's voice is heard. Effective strategies can include:
Encouraging quieter participants to share their thoughts
Using breakout sessions for smaller group interactions
Respecting different communication styles and allowing time for reflection
By focusing on these elements, organizations can design leadership communication workshops that not only enhance team communication but also celebrate the diversity of the group, fostering a stronger, more cohesive team environment.

Facilitating Leadership Communication Workshops
The success of leadership communication workshops for diverse teams greatly hinges on the skills of the facilitator. An effective facilitator not only guides the conversation but also creates an inclusive atmosphere where all participants feel valued and heard. Here are some essential strategies for facilitating these workshops:
Role of the Facilitator in Guiding Discussions
Facilitators should be equipped with the ability to steer discussions while ensuring that the input from all participants is acknowledged. Key aspects of this role include:
Establishing Ground Rules: Setting clear expectations for behavior can foster a safe environment. Ground rules might include respect for differing opinions and the importance of confidentiality.
Encouraging Participation: Actively inviting quieter team members to share their thoughts can lead to more balanced discussions. Utilizing techniques like round-robin sharing can facilitate this.
Strategies for Managing Diverse Perspectives
Within diverse teams, multiple perspectives can emerge that may lead to conflicts or misunderstandings. Effective facilitators should employ techniques such as:
Fostering Open Dialogue: Encourage participants to express their viewpoints without fear of judgment. This could be achieved through structured activities that allow for open feedback.
Navigating Conflicts: Having strategies to address conflicts constructively can help maintain a positive atmosphere. Techniques such as mediation or collaborative problem-solving can be very effective.
Techniques for Fostering Open Communication
Facilitators should promote an environment where open communication is valued. Here are some effective techniques to achieve this:
Active Listening Exercises: Practice exercises that emphasize listening skills—such as summarizing what a colleague has said—can enhance understanding within the team.
Feedback Loops: Implementing regular check-ins allows team members to express concerns or suggestions throughout the workshop, reinforcing the importance of ongoing dialogue.
By employing these strategies, facilitators can create an enriching environment during leadership communication workshops for diverse teams, ensuring that all members thrive and contribute to the goals of the organization.

Measuring the Impact of Workshops
Evaluating the effectiveness of leadership communication workshops for diverse teams is crucial for continuous improvement and validation of the training process. Understanding the impacts and outcomes of these workshops allows organizations to refine their approach and better meet the needs of their teams. Here are some ways to effectively measure the impact of these workshops:
Key Performance Indicators for Workshop Success
To assess the effectiveness of the workshops, organizations should establish clear Key Performance Indicators (KPIs). These can include:
Participant Feedback: Gathering immediate feedback through surveys or questionnaires at the end of each session to understand participant satisfaction and perceived value.
Behavioral Observations: Monitoring shifts in interpersonal dynamics and communication styles during team interactions post-workshop.
Retention Rates: Analyzing staff retention and turnover rates before and after the workshops to see if there's an improvement linked to enhanced communication.
Gathering Feedback and Continuous Improvement
Creating a culture of feedback is essential to the growth and adaptation of leadership communication workshops. Consider these strategies for effective feedback collection:
Pre- and Post-Workshop Surveys: Administering surveys before and after the workshops to gauge relevant changes in attitudes and skills can provide quantitative data on their effectiveness.
Follow-Up Focus Groups: Organizing discussions after the workshop can give deeper insights into the long-term impacts and highlight areas for improvement.
Longitudinal Studies: Tracking the performance of teams that have undergone training versus those that haven’t over an extended period can yield valuable data on the effectiveness of the workshops.
Regularly assessing the impact of leadership communication workshops for diverse teams not only helps in refining the content and delivery but also reinforces the organization’s commitment to nurturing effective leaders.
